Geek Alliance LLCThe legendary 1995 role-playing game Chrono Trigger is currently celebrating its 30th anniversary, and as part of this, Square Enix has provided a sales update.
According to an official post on its website, combined sales (across all platforms) since the game’s original Super Famicom release have now surpassed over five million copies worldwide.
